When is the best time to book a Bed & Breakfast in Spartanburg?
The best time to book a B&B in Spartanburg is during the vibrant months of July through September, when the area truly comes alive with activity. This peak season coincides with warm temperatures, often ranging from the mid-70s to the low 90s Fahrenheit, making it ideal for outdoor exploration and events. Visitors can immerse themselves in local festivals, enjoy scenic parks, and take part in a variety of recreational activities.

September, in particular, is a standout month to visit Spartanburg, as the summer heat begins to ease, providing a comfortable atmosphere for sightseeing. This transitional period allows travelers to enjoy outdoor attractions like the beautiful Croft State Park or the picturesque downtown area with its charming shops and eateries, while still engaging with the local community during events that celebrate the region's rich history.

For those seeking a more budget-friendly option, December presents a wonderful opportunity to experience Spartanburg's holiday spirit. The city is transformed with festive decorations, and visitors can partake in seasonal events without the hustle and bustle of the peak tourist crowd.
